Laurence S. “Larry” Sexton, age 80, of Plano, Texas, passed away peacefully on February 23, 2026. He was born on September 23, 1945, in Oakland, California, to William and Betty Sexton.
Larry grew up in Bellflower, California, and graduated from Bellflower High School. At 19, he was drafted into the United States Army and proudly served in Vietnam from 1964 until his honorable discharge in 1968. After returning home, he began a long and successful career with GTE—later Verizon—starting as a telephone pole repairman and working his way up to a computer programmer before retiring. Never one to sit still, Larry later spent time selling cars for Chevrolet and even earned his real estate license.
Larry loved spending time on the golf course with friends, his father Bill, and his son Brian. He also enjoyed following the stock market and once took the family on a memorable trip to New York, where visiting the New York Stock Exchange was a highlight he talked about for years.
Above all, Larry was a devoted father and grandfather who gave his family a childhood filled with joy, adventure, and memories they will cherish forever.
Larry will be lovingly remembered by wife, Carolyn; children Shelley, Sarah, and Brian; Carolyn’s children Steve and Julie; grandchildren and great-grandchildren and sister Carolyn Graffio. He was welcomed into Heaven by his parents, his sister Sherill, and Carolyn’s daughter Stacy.
Larry will be forever in our hearts.
There will be a memorial mass at 2:00 p.m., Friday, March 13, 2026, at St. Elizabeth Ann Seton Catholic Church, Plano, Texas.
